"Tara" wrote in message ... What she conveniently neglected to mention is that those Pit bulls that are no longer dying in the "fight rings" are now dying by the boatload in the shelters. Automatic euthanasia for any Pit brought into a shelter there. That's not progress. That's nothing more than avoidance coupled with a lot of blood on their hands. hopefully, that is no longer the case. http://acf2004.tripod.com/ OHIO SEPTEMBER 2004: The Ohio Supreme Court (State v Cowan) ruled ORC955:22 as applied to 955:11 is unconstitutional because it denies dog owners due process and supports the Toledo decision where the court is granting dog owners due process over Pit Bull ownership. These two cases are for the first time a major decision in the right direction. Never before in Ohio's history have there been decisions handed down like in the Tellings and Cowan cases. Accurate statisitcs show breed bans do not protect the public, do not stop illegal activity and only target responsible dog owners while causing the extermination of thousands of innocent family pets. Breed bans also criminalize US citizens by dogs denying them due process. -kelly |

Breed bans also criminalize US citizens by dogs denying them due process. oops, here's the toledo decision referenced in the release above: TOLEDO OHIO: ACF constitutional challenge (Tellings v Lucas County Dog Warden) July 2004. **The Toledo Muni Court ruled that American Pit Bull Terriers are not dangerous.** The court however did not rule on all the challenges raised and ACF is appealing. The court did however rule that dog owners are exempt from the Ohio breed specific law by proving their dog has not bitten in the past. -kelly |
